When to Buy a Play Mat

Quick answer: Many families buy a play mat before regular tummy time and floor play begin, often during late pregnancy or the newborn stage. The goal is to have a clean, flat, supervised floor zone ready when baby starts spending more awake time on the floor.

Have it ready early

A mat can be useful for awake, supervised floor sessions once your family and pediatrician are ready for tummy time. Buying early also gives time to choose a color and size calmly.

It can grow with the room

A neutral, right-sized mat can move from nursery floor time into crawling, toddler play, or shared living-room use as needs change.
